With this ticket, you'll get admission to the Museum of Fantastic Illusions in Prague. You’ll discover that the museum has over 100 interactive entertainment exhibits, trick paintings and optical illusions. You can sit in the magic chair that turns you into a dwarf or a giant. You can also walk on the ceiling, turn into a ballerina or watch a wizard levitate in the air. Additionally, you can enjoy entertaining optical illusions featuring King Kong, the alchemist Edward Kelly, Albert Einstein and Charlie Chaplin. You can also visit the Myšák café and patisserie next to the museum, after your experience.

Please note that the operational hours of the Museum of Fantastic Illusions are daily from 09:00 to 21:00, and from 09:00 to 15:00 on 24 and 31 December.

Please note that strollers, food, drinks, animals and weapons are not allowed.

Please note that you can safely leave the strollers at the cash desk for free.

The museum is located on the first floor of the Myšák Gallery at Vodičkova Street 31, near Wenceslas Square.

You can reach the museum by tram or by metro lines A and B.
